MLS # 86693179 the utd wayWebOct 10, 2024 · Soon after harvesting, the hull – the hard outer coating of the nut – needs to be removed. If not removed in a timely manner, the stain from the hull can leech inside and discolor the meat. This staining will also result in an undesirable off-flavor.
